Maybe Josh was right that he was the only one who would put up with my increasing level of crazy.
Elbows pressed onto the cool counter, I smacked my face into both palms and raked my fingers back until they tugged through my loose strands.
No. Josh was not right. He was a manipulating asshole who made me dependent on him by making me feel unwanted and unlovable.
Though it was difficult to not see a sliver of truth in his blunt words. Who would want to put up with someone like me long term? My mental state most days was the definition of a shit show, not a hot mess. Looking back, I knew that was why I’d settled for Josh—I thought he was the best someone like me could do.
After that first time he cheated on me, then blamed me, claiming he did it because I worked too much and was never home, I should’ve left. But by that point, I believed his lies, questioning myself and what I had to offer anyone else.
Until a smirking, good-looking detective strolled into the morgue one day.
The man who helped me see through Josh’s lies and manipulations was now back in my life, this time as an FBI agent here to help identify a serial killer. Back then, Jameson was casual about uncovering the issues in my marriage that I wanted to keep hidden. Not sure how he put everything together, but he did. Six months after we first met, our innocent flirting turned pointed, even uplifting in a way. He would constantly build me up, telling me over and over that I was enough.
Not enough for him or anyone else, but for me.
In his own unique way, Jameson gave me the strength to be okay with loving myself just the way I am, quirks and all. I didn’t have to conform to Josh’s needs or wants if they didn’t align with my own—which they never did.
And now that amazing man was here.
My past crush working side by side with my current one.
“Fuck,” I muttered to my reflection. “I can’t even keep my heart rate normal with Slade in the room. I’ll turn into a puddle of mush when it’s both of them.” One hand slipped down my neck, fingers wrapping around the base of my throat. “Both of them,” I whispered, licking my lips. “Me between them—”
The familiar vibration of an incoming text jerked me out of losing myself to the very dirty fantasy. Pulling out my cell, I skimmed the text letting me know the body was back at the morgue and waiting for me. Time to get back to work now that I knew for certain my house wouldn’t turn into ground zero for setting the entire state of California on fire.
As I turned to head for the door, my fingers shifted along a texture different from my smooth cell phone case. Pausing, I rotated my hand to see what was stuck back there.
The note.
What if all my worrying projected into the universe and this was from a neighbor wanting to get to know me? Which could be great, but my nose wrinkled at the thought of all the effort it took to build friendships. An extrovert I was not, so starting a flimsy acquaintance with this unknown neighbor sounded exhausting.
Preparing for the worst, I unfolded the notebook paper.
Three words.
That was all it took to erase all concerns of the hypothetical neighbor friendship, douse the smoldering flames the thoughts of Slade, Jameson, and me together stoked, and make me forget all about the dead body waiting for me at the morgue.
I found you
“Damnit,” I whispered, the paper shaking between my fingers.
Was my dad right about being worried for my safety?
Was I in danger?

My head is spinning and pounding at the same time, and it has nothing to do with the loud music playing at this wedding reception or the obnoxious amount of liquor I’ve consumed.
Okay, the spinning is because of the booze. But the pounding? That’s because my best friend Wes is a fucking idiot. I’m hammered out of my damn mind and even I see that. And I’m seeing three of everything right now.
“It’s your future that’s going to be alone and miserable.”
Wes shoots a glare to our friend Simon, who isn’t backing down to Wes’s insane logic. “But her future is what I’m trying to save!”
“Is she not a part of your future?”
Wes snaps a look to Shane, our friend who usually keeps his mouth shut. Hell, Simon and I both are now staring at the normally broody one of the bunch, surprised he chimed in.
“What did you say?” Wes asks.
Shane leans his elbows on the table. “I said, before this fight, was Betsy not part of your future?”
“Of course she was.”
“Then why can’t you be part of hers?”
Damn…I can actually feel my brain explode with the truth bomb Shane just dropped.
I look over to Wes, who still hasn’t said anything.
Is he really this dense? He has to be. He has this amazing woman who came into his life when he least expected it, fell in love with him, loves his kids like they are her own, and yet because he can’t get out of his own way, he’s going to fuck everything up.
Does he not realize people would kill for that kind of partner? That it’s what some of us look for our entire lives? That some of us—me—are starting to think that it’s just not in the cards? Is he really going to throw that away?
“She loves you, Wes,” I say. I think I interrupted him, but I don’t give a shit. “She loves the kids. She’s the kind of woman you hope to fall in love with one day. I don’t know what’s going on in your head but don’t push that away. Some of us look for this kind of love our entire lives. You have it. And now look at it.”
I nod to the dance floor where Betsy is dancing with one of Wes’s former Nashville Fury teammates. It’s a slower song—a wedding staple, if you ask me. Everyone who’s here with a date is on the dance floor.
Which means that’s my cue for another trip to the bar.
I love weddings. I’m the best wedding date there is if I do say so myself. I like to dance and have fun. I will lead any conga line. Need a dancing partner for the great-grandmother? I’m your guy. Need someone to hype the newlyweds up? I’m here for it.
And when it comes to catching the garters? No one is better than me. Most guys run away from it. Not me. I’ll grab that thing every fucking time and celebrate like I just caught a foul ball at a Tennessee Arrows game.
The old wives’ tale is that when you catch it, you’re next. Bullshit. It’s all bullshit. I’ve caught seventeen of them. Yet here I am, still alone.
“Jack and Coke.”
I don’t know why I needed to say it. I’ve been to the bar so many times tonight this man knows my drink by now. He sets it in front of me, and I turn around to watch the couples on the dance floor.
I should be out there. I thought Shannon, the girl I was seeing as of today, was going to turn into something special. Yes, it was stupid to say what I said. And I apologized. Apparently she’s never said or done anything stupid before, like proposing marriage during sex.
Whatever. That just means she wasn’t the one. The woman who I’m supposed to be with is out there somewhere. One day I’ll find her.
Hopefully. Maybe. Possibly.
“Jack and Coke. Make it a double.”
I look to my left and nearly lose my footing. And not because of the six Jack and Cokes I’ve had tonight. It’s because of the woman standing next to me.
She’s that damn gorgeous.
Her fiery red hair is sleek and smooth, running down past her shoulders. The gold dress she’s wearing is fitted and catching every one of her mouthwatering curves. And a woman who drinks Jack and Coke? Now that’s my type.
And because I’m so drunk, I’m seeing two of her.
Double the pleasure, double the fun.
“Do you want to dance?”
She turns to look at me, and even in my drunkenness I can tell she doesn’t know if I was talking to her.
“Excuse me?”
I nod over to the dance floor. “I asked if you’d like to dance?”
“Do you always ask strangers to dance?”
“Only the beautiful ones.”
She rolls her eyes. “Now that’s a line if I’ve ever heard one.”
I shake my head. “Not a line.”
“Really?”
“Really.”
“Well, sorry,” she says as she takes her drink from the bartender. “I don’t dance.”
“What do you mean you don’t dance? Who doesn’t dance?”
“Me,” she says before taking a sip. “Sorry to ruin your night.”
She turns back to the bar, but I don’t let that stop me. I’m persistent, if nothing else. It’s part of my charm. At least I like to think so.
“I’m Oliver.”
I extend my hand to her, because that’s what drunk me feels like is the right thing to do at the moment. For a second I think she’s just going to walk away. She looks down at my hand and then back up to me. I’m about to pull it back and crack a joke to make it a little less awkward when her hand meets mine. I don’t know if it’s the booze or what, but I swear I think I was just electrocuted.
“Nice to meet you Oliver. I’m Izzy. How about another drink?”

“Can I get you anything else?” I ask, my eyes darting to the door. It’s crazy busy and I need to get back. I also wouldn’t mind putting some distance between the two of us. His presence is magnetic, and it concerns me that I’ve noticed. 

Little beads of sweat cling to his brow before he swipes them away with the back of his hand. His disarming smile is firmly in place as he stalks toward me. “Just your company.” He moves in closer, and his breath tickles my face when he speaks. “What’s your name, and do you go to school here too?” Curiosity lights up his handsome face as his inquisitive gaze probes mine. 

“Why do you want to know?” I step sideways to create some distance between us. 

“I’m just making conversation.”

There’s a weird tension in the air. A crackling charge ripping across the space separating our bodies, and I don’t like feeling some freaky connection between us. “Well, I’m working, and they need me outside, so I should go.”

“It’s too quiet in here, and I don’t like hanging around by myself.” His earnest eyes are shielding nothing, and I know it isn’t a lie or a ruse to trap me into spending time with him. “Not when I’m pumped full of adrenaline. Normally, my friends would be here, but they all had shit to do tonight.” His eyes soften. “You’d be doing me a big favor if you kept me company.” He flops down on the couch, still maintaining eye contact with me. He pats the space beside him. “I only have a short break, and I promise I won’t bite.”He flashes me another ovary-clenching smile. “I’m betting you haven’t taken a break all night. Rest your feet and take a breather.”

A break does sound nice, and he’s right. I wasn’t able to take my usual ten minutes earlier because it was too busy. Suddenly, my feet feel heavy, and my legs ache like they might go out from under me. 

Garrick hops up and grabs two chilled bottles of water from the mini refrigerator as I lower my tired butt onto the couch. Fridays are always nightmarish because I have classes until lunch, then I work my shift at Butterfly Flowers, and run back to the apartment I share off-campus with my friend Ellen to grab something to eat and a quick shower before showing up for my shift at the bar. I usually sleep in late on Saturday morning, too exhausted to get up early. 

“You look like you need this as much as me,” he says, handing me a water.

 “Thanks, and I do. It’s hot out there tonight.”

“It’s a veritable sauna, ”he agrees. “If it’s like this every Friday night, I might start showing up in nothing but shorts.”

“That would be one way of keeping your fans loyal,” I tease as I uncap the bottle. 

“I’m here for the music, not the girls.” He flashes me a flirty look, that seems to contradict his statement, before gulping back his drink. 

“Said no rock star ever,” I deadpan, fighting a grin. “I’m not a rock star nor do I have any desire to be.”

“How come? You must know you’re good, and isn’t it what most musicians dream of?”

He shrugs before draining his second bottle of water and tossing the empty in the trash can. “Not me. Music is a hobby. It’s a release. A way to indulge my creative side. It will never be anything more.”

“It seems a shame to waste such natural talent, but I admire you for knowing what you want and sticking to your resolve.”

“I still don’t know your name.” He twists around on the couch. His knee brushes against my jean-clad leg as he leans in closer, giving me his undivided attention. 

It’s unnerving, but I still can’t force myself to get up and leave. 

“And you didn’t tell me if you go to UO too,” he adds, looking at me like I’m the most fascinating person in the world. 

“I’m Stevie, and yes, I go to school here. I’m studying floral management and just about to finish my sophomore year.”

“Same here.” 

My eyes pop wide. I’m pretty sure there are no guys in any of my classes. Floral management is not really a guy thing. 

He chuckles. “I meant I’m a sophomore. I’m majoring in family enterprise.”

“Oh, cool. Does your family have a business?”

He nods as his tongue darts out wetting his lips. “My dad is CEO of Allen Lumber and Allen Wineries. I’ll be joining the business when I graduate.”

His tone is very matter-of-fact, and it doesn’t seem like he’s bragging. Wouldn’t matter if he was. I’m hard to impress, and I can’t think of any guy who has ever managed to do it. “I know Allen Wineries. The country club I used to work at back home buys their wine. So, you’re from Seattle too?”

“Born and bred.”

“What part?”

“Dad lives in North Bend, and Mom lives in Medina. I used to split my time between both homes.” Air trickles out of his mouth as he drags one hand through his messy dark hair. 

Something akin to desire pools low in my belly, but I ignore it. 

“What about you? Where do you call home?” he asks.

 “Ravenna. I live with my mom, and my nana is close by too.”

“No dad?”

“I never knew him.” I’m not about to get into it with a guy who is a virtual stranger even if he seems like an okay guy and the conversation is flowing easily. 

“This feels a little like fate.” His eyes sparkle with excitement. 

“What does?”

“Us meeting like this.”

I resist the urge to roll my eyes. “It’s coincidence. Not fate. And it’s not like there aren’t a ton of people attending Oregon from Seattle.”

“True, but I’m sticking to my convictions. You call it coincidence. I’m calling it fate.” He attempts to dazzle me with that flirty smile again, and it almost works. Angling his body closer, he stares at my mouth like he wants to kiss me.
